Paneer Chilli Puffs-SK Khazana

Advertisment
Main Ingredients Cottage cheese (paneer), Green chillies
Cuisine Fusion
Course Snacks and Starters
Prep Time 16-20 minutes
Cook time 26-30 minutes
Serve 4
Taste Mild
Level of Cooking Easy
Others Veg

Ingredients list for Paneer Chilli Puffs-SK Khazana

  • 100 grams Cottage cheese (paneer) cut into small cubes
  • 2 Green chillies diagonally sliced
  • 1 Medium green capsicum cut into medium square pieces
  • 250 grams Puff pastry douh
  • 1 tablespo for greasing Oil
  • 1 Medium onion cut into small cubes
  • 1 tablespoon Garlic finely chopped
  • 1 tablespoon Soy sauce
  • 1 cup Vegetable stock
  • 1 tablespoon Cornflour slurry
  • to taste Black peppercorns crushed
  • to taste Salt
  • 1 tablespoon Spring onion greens finely chopped
  • for brushi Butter
  • to sprinkle White sesame seeds (safed til)

Method

  1. Heat oil in a non-stick pan. Add onion and sauté till translucent. Add garlic and mix.
  2. Add green chillies and capsicum, mix and saute for a minute. Add soy sauce, mix well and cook for a minute.
  3. Add vegetable stock and cornflour slurry, mix well and bring to a boil. Add crushed peppercorns and salt and mix.
  4. Add cottage cheese, mix well and cook till the mixture thickens. Add spring onion greens and mix well. Remove from heat and set aside.
  5. Preheat oven to 180º C. Grease a baking tray with some oil.
  6. Dust the worktop with some dry flour and roll out puff pastry dough into a large sheet. Trim the edges to make a neat square. Further cut into 4 equal squares.
  7. Place a spoonful of cottage cheese mixture in the centre of each square, bring the four corners to the centre and seal to make square puffs.
  8. Place the puffs on the greased tray, brush them with some butter and sprinkle some sesame seeds on top.
  9. Place the tray in the preheated oven and bake for 15-20 minutes.
  10. Serve hot with sweet chilli sauce.
